Our A1-A2 courses are designed for those new to the French language. In these classes, you will:

1. Basic Vocabulary and Phrases:

  • Common greetings and introductions: "Bonjour, je m'appelle [Nom]." (Hello, my name is [Name].)
  • Numbers, days of the week, and colors: "Aujourd'hui, c'est lundi." (Today is Monday.)
  • Simple directions and daily expressions: "Où sont les toilettes?" (Where is the bathroom?)

2. Fundamental Grammar:

  • Articles (definite and indefinite): "Le chat, un chat" (The cat, a cat)
  • Present tense verb conjugations: "Je viens, tu viens, il/elle vient" (I come, you come, he/she comes)
  • Sentence structure: Subject-Verb-Object order

3. Listening and Speaking Skills:

  • Pronunciation practice with native audio clips
  • Basic conversational phrases: "Comment allez-vous?" (How are you?)
  • Role-plays for real-life situations

4. Reading and Writing Exercises:

  • Short texts and dialogues: Reading simple stories
  • Writing simple sentences: "J'aime le football." (I like soccer)
  • Comprehension exercises to test understanding

5. Cultural Insights:

  • Introduction to French culture and traditions
  • Basic etiquette and customs

Key Outcomes

  • Introduce yourself and others
  • Ask and answer questions about personal details
  • Hold basic conversations on familiar topics
  • Read and write simple texts

Our C1-C2 courses are aimed at advanced learners who wish to achieve fluency and a deep understanding of the French language. In these classes, you will:

1. Mastery of Vocabulary:

  • Idiomatic expressions and advanced vocabulary: "Il pleut des cordes." (It's raining cats and dogs)
  • Specialized vocabulary for various fields

2. Complex Grammar:

  • Advanced tenses and moods
  • Passive voice, indirect speech
  • Nuances of French grammar

3. Listening and Speaking Skills:

  • Advanced discussions and presentations
  • Debates and role-plays on complex topics

4. Reading and Writing:

  • Analyzing literature, academic articles
  • Writing detailed essays, reports, and critiques

5. Cultural and Professional Insights:

  • Understanding French business culture
  • Preparing for proficiency exams like DELF, DALF

Key Outcomes

  • Express ideas fluently and spontaneously
  • Use language flexibly for social, academic, and professional purposes
  • Produce detailed, well-structured texts
  • Understand and engage with native speakers in complex conversations
